betroth 0781 ## >aras {aw-ras'}; a primitive root; to engage for
matrimony: -- {betroth}, espouse. [ql

betroth 2778 ## charaph. {khaw-raf'}; a primitive root; to pull
off, i.e. (by implication) to expose (as by stripping);
specifically, to betroth (as if a surrender); figuratively, to
carp at, i.e. defame; denominative (from 2779) to spend the
winter: -- {betroth}, blaspheme, defy, jeopard, rail, reproach,
upbraid. [ql
